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Maesteg (Ewenny Road) to Stromeferry start from as little as £101.30

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Maesteg (Ewenny Road) to Stromeferry are available for £306.70 one way, or £533.40 return

Facilities and Amenities

Although small, Maesteg (Ewenny Road) train station is equipped to meet the needs of travelers. Featuring accessible ticket machines, individuals can easily collect tickets purchased online. While a ticket office is absent, the card-only machines ensure hassle-free transactions. There's also an induction loop for those who require it. Although the station does not offer many conveniences, passengers have access to seating areas to relax before their journey.

Accessibility is partial at Maesteg (Ewenny Road). While there is step-free access via a steep ramp, it lacks handrails, categorizing the station as B1 for accessibility. Customer support is primarily available through the helpline, ensuring assistance is just a call away.

Essentially, the station provides the basics, with no facilities for waiting rooms, toilets, or refreshments. Passengers should plan accordingly, especially if traveling with young children or requiring particular amenities.

Transport Links

Maesteg (Ewenny Road) station offers a rail replacement bus service for your convenience, particularly important during times of disruption or planned closures. The designated bus stop is conveniently located at the station entrance on Oakwood Drive. Unfortunately, there are no bicycle hire facilities or dedicated taxi services at the station, so consider making arrangements in advance if these are required.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Stromeferry Train Station may be minimalistic, but that's part of its charm. While the station lacks a ticket office or ticket machines, ticket purchasing can conveniently be handled in advance online. The absence of amenities like shops, ATMs, and refreshment facilities encourages travelers to come prepared for their journey. However, there's an induction loop for the hearing impaired and a seating area where you can wait for your train.

For accessibility, the station provides step-free access to the platforms, making it partially wheelchair-friendly, although there are no ramps for train access. It's important to take note of the stepping distance between train and platform, which can be significant here. There are no toilets or baby changing facilities available, so plan accordingly.

Transport Links and Connections

Getting to and from Stromeferry is straightforward, even without extensive facilities. There is a small car park with 20 free parking spaces available 24 hours a day, ideal for those driving in. For further onward travel, you can check ///what3words for bus pick-up locations in front of the station. Taxi services are accessible through resources like TrainTaxi for those needing additional connectivity. Additionally, bus service details can be found via Traveline Scotland, either on their website or through their 24-hour hotline.
